WebThe ladder arrangement consists of two resistors i.e. a base resistor R and a 2R resistor which is twice the value of the base resistor. This feature helps to maintain a precise output analog signal without using a wide … Web2R resistor ladder network, which requires only two precision resistor values R and 2R. A 4-bit R-2R resistor ladder network is shown below: The digital input to the DAC is a 4-bit binary number represented by bits b0, b1, b2 and b3, where b0 is the least significant bit (LSB) and b3 is the most significant bit (MSB).

It is only necessary that the "2R" value matches the sum of … See more • ECE209: DAC Lecture Notes - Ohio State University • EE247: D/A Converters - Berkeley University of California • Simplified DAC/ADC Lecture Notes - University of Michigan See more A basic R–2R resistor ladder network is shown in Figure 1. Bit an−1 (most significant bit, MSB) through bit a0 (least significant bit, LSB) are driven from digital logic gates. Ideally, the bit inputs are switched between V = 0 (logic 0) and V = Vref (logic 1).
